Add list_feather_columns function in eager mode
This PR adds list_feather_columns function in eager mode, so that it is possible to get the column name and spec information for feather format. This PR implements an `::arrow::io::RandomAccessFile` interface so it is possible to read files through scheme file system, e.g., s3, gcs, azfs, etc. The `::arrow::io::RandomAccessFile` is the same as in Parquet PR 384 so they could be combined.
